Speculations on the pervasiveness of cinematic vision, traced back beyond the invention of the magic lantern and camera obscura. Based upon an essay first published in 1937. Muti-media careers of Polish film artists Stefan and Franciszka Themerson, who lived and worked in London for over forty years.
